Default Re: Big Block Chevy Oil Pan

I've never noticed a date stamp before.
For ALL 8cyl.,I look at the width of the rear lip.
If it's 3/8 rounded,it's 1968 & earlier.
If it's 5/8 flat,it's 1970 & later.
